Skip to content

Commit 9c712b9

Browse files
committed
fix: broken system settings
1 parent 8e60355 commit 9c712b9

File tree

3 files changed

+5
-3
lines changed

3 files changed

+5
-3
lines changed

meteor/server/collections/index.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-62,6 +62,7 @@ export const CoreSystem = createAsyncOnlyMongoCollection<ICoreSystem>(Collection
6262
'logo',
6363
'blueprintId',
6464
'settingsWithOverrides',
65+
'enableMonitorBlockedThread',
6566
])
6667
},
6768
})

meteor/server/publications/system.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,6 +21,7 @@ meteorPublish(MeteorPubSub.coreSystem, async function (_token: string | undefine
2121
blueprintId: 1,
2222
logo: 1,
2323
settingsWithOverrides: 1,
24+
enableMonitorBlockedThread: 1,
2425
},
2526
})
2627
})

packages/webui/src/client/ui/Settings/SystemManagement.tsx

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-215,7 +215,7 @@ function SystemManagementEvaluationsMessage({ coreSystem }: Readonly<WithCoreSys
215215
label={t('Enabled')}
216216
item={wrappedItem}
217217
// @ts-expect-error deep property
218-
itemKey={'evaluations.enabled'}
218+
itemKey={'evaluationsMessage.enabled'}
219219
overrideHelper={overrideHelper}
220220
>
221221
{(value, handleUpdate) => <CheckboxControl value={!!value} handleUpdate={handleUpdate} />}
@@ -225,7 +225,7 @@ function SystemManagementEvaluationsMessage({ coreSystem }: Readonly<WithCoreSys
225225
label={t('Heading')}
226226
item={wrappedItem}
227227
// @ts-expect-error deep property
228-
itemKey={'evaluations.heading'}
228+
itemKey={'evaluationsMessage.heading'}
229229
overrideHelper={overrideHelper}
230230
>
231231
{(value, handleUpdate) => (
@@ -242,7 +242,7 @@ function SystemManagementEvaluationsMessage({ coreSystem }: Readonly<WithCoreSys
242242
label={t('Message')}
243243
item={wrappedItem}
244244
// @ts-expect-error deep property
245-
itemKey={'evaluations.message'}
245+
itemKey={'evaluationsMessage.message'}
246246
overrideHelper={overrideHelper}
247247
hint={t('Message shown to users in the Evaluations form')}
248248
>

0 commit comments

Comments
 (0)